That’s quite the development. The hot topic this week in wrestling has been the Hardys status. It’s not clear if they’re going to head to WWE or anywhere else for that matter but one thing is known for sure: they’re going to be at the Ring of Honor “Supercard of Honor XI” to challenge the Young Bucks for the Ring of Honor Tag Team Titles. That was the plan at least, but now that plan has been broken.

At tonight’s Ring of Honor “Manhattan Mayhem” event, the Young Bucks successfully defended the Ring of Honor World Tag Team Titles against Jay White and Lio Rush. After the match, the lights went out and the Broken Hardys appeared. A challenge was issued and the titles were on the line then and there. The Hardys won a quick match and became the new champions. This makes them the first team to win the WWE, TNA and Ring of Honor Tag Team Titles. They also held the WWE version of the WCW Tag Team Titles.
